When you’re working with Axios, it’s easy to overlook small details. For example, if you’re using PUT, you need to ensure that the URL is correct and that the request body matches the expected structure. It’s similar with POST, where the format of the data sent matters. A mismatch here can lead to errors that seem mysterious at first but have clear solutions.

One of the first things to check is your network connection. If there’s a hiccup in the network, Axios might not be able to send the request. Make sure your device and browser are connected properly. Also, check if there are any firewall settings blocking the connection. These are often overlooked but can cause significant issues.

Another thing to consider is the server response. When you try to use PUT or POST, the server might return a status code that indicates failure. For instance, a 404 or 500 error means something went wrong on the other side. Understanding these codes is crucial for debugging.

If you’re dealing with data formatting, pay close attention. Axios expects specific data structures, especially for JSON payloads. If you’re sending a form or API key, double-check that it’s included correctly. A tiny mistake here can break the request.

Don’t forget about headers. Sometimes, the right headers are missing, or their values are incorrect. These can affect whether the request is accepted or not. It’s a small detail, but it makes a big difference.

It’s also helpful to use debugging tools. Tools like the console in your browser or logging statements can help you track what’s happening during the request. This way, you can pinpoint the exact issue and fix it quickly.

If you’re still facing problems after these checks, it might be time to revisit your server configuration. Ensure that your backend is set up to handle these methods properly. CORS policies, authentication tokens, and endpoint settings are all important factors.
